The Simple Secret: Core Ingredients for Your High-Protein Chia Pudding
One of the most appealing aspects of creating delicious
meal prep protein chia pudding cups is the remarkably short and accessible ingredient list. You likely have most of these staples in your pantry right now!
*
Chia Seeds: The star of the show! These tiny powerhouses are incredible for thickening your pudding as they absorb liquid and create a gel-like consistency. Did you know there are both black and white chia seeds? Both are nutritionally identical, so feel free to use whichever you prefer or have on hand. A single tablespoon of chia seeds contributes approximately 4 grams of protein, alongside a wealth of fiber and heart-healthy omega-3s.
*
Liquid Base (Milk): While almond milk is a popular choice for its mild flavor and creamy texture, the options are truly endless.
*
Full-fat coconut milk will yield an exceptionally thick and rich pudding, reminiscent of a dessert.
*
Oat milk offers a naturally sweet and creamy alternative.
*
Soy milk provides additional protein.
* Even regular dairy milk works beautifully. Choose the milk that best suits your dietary preferences and desired consistency.
*
Protein Powder: This is where the "high-protein" magic happens! The type of protein powder you choose can significantly impact the final flavor and texture.
*
Whey protein (isolate or concentrate) often dissolves smoothly and comes in a vast array of flavors.
*
Plant-based proteins (like pea, brown rice, or a blended vegan protein) are excellent for those avoiding dairy. Be aware that some plant proteins can have a slightly grittier texture or unique flavor profile.
* **Crucial Tip:** Protein powders vary wildly in sweetness and flavor. We highly recommend mixing your protein powder into the chia and milk first, tasting it, and *then* deciding how much (if any) additional sweetener you need. This prevents an overly sweet or unbalanced pudding. Brands like Garden of Life, Simply Tera's, Sun Warrior, and Aloha are often recommended for their quality and fewer fillers.
*
Sweetener (e.g., Maple Syrup): To complement your protein powder, a touch of natural sweetness can elevate your pudding. Maple syrup is a fantastic choice, but honey, agave nectar, or even sugar-free alternatives like stevia or erythritol can be used. Adjust to your personal preference, keeping in mind the sweetness level of your chosen protein powder.
*
Vanilla Extract: A splash of vanilla enhances all the other flavors, adding a warm, inviting note.
*
A Pinch of Salt: Don't skip this! A tiny amount of salt balances the sweetness and brings out the depth of flavor in the pudding.

Achieving Optimal Thickness & Texture
The key to a satisfying chia pudding lies in its texture.
*
The Overnight Advantage: For the absolute best, "SUPER thick" chia pudding, let your ingredients sit in the refrigerator overnight. This allows the chia seeds ample time to fully hydrate and swell, creating an incredibly creamy, spoonable consistency that truly feels indulgent.
*
Quick Soak Option: If you're short on time, a minimum of 2 hours in the fridge should be enough for the pudding to thicken sufficiently for a delicious result. However, for maximum creaminess and a pudding that holds up well for meal prep, overnight is always preferred.
*
Whisk it Well: When combining your ingredients, especially after adding protein powder, whisk thoroughly to prevent clumps. A vigorous whisking for a minute or two, followed by another stir after 5-10 minutes, ensures even distribution and helps the chia seeds absorb liquid uniformly.

Smart Storage for Lasting Freshness
Proper storage is essential for successful meal prepping.
*
Airtight Containers: Always store your chia pudding in individual airtight containers in the refrigerator. This not only keeps it fresh but also prevents it from absorbing any odors from other foods in your fridge. Small mason jars or single-serving meal prep containers are ideal for this.
*
Longevity: When stored correctly, your
meal prep protein chia pudding cups will stay fresh and delicious for 5-7 days, making them perfect for a full week's worth of healthy breakfasts or snacks.
